Create a New Claude Code Agent (Subagent)

What You Are Doing

You are helping the user create a Claude Code Custom Agent - a markdown file with YAML frontmatter that defines a specialized AI assistant running in an isolated context. Agents live in .claude/agents/<name>.md (project) or ~/.claude/agents/<name>.md (global) and are spawned via the Task tool when Claude detects a matching task or when explicitly requested.

Why Agents Matter

  • Specialization - Agents focus on one job (reviewing, testing, debugging) and do it well
  • Isolation - They run in their own context window, keeping the main conversation clean
  • Safety - Tool restrictions and permission modes limit what an agent can do
  • Parallelism - Multiple agents can work simultaneously on independent tasks
  • Memory - Agents can learn across sessions with persistent memory

Process

Step 1: Fetch Latest Documentation

Use the Task tool with subagent_type: "claude-code-guide" to fetch the latest agent/subagent documentation. Do NOT skip this step.

Step 2: Understand What the User Wants

Before creating anything, figure out:

  1. What should this agent do? - Check $ARGUMENTS and conversation context
  2. What tools does it need? - Read-only? Write access? Bash? MCP tools?
  3. How autonomous should it be? - Permission mode matters

Step 3: Ask Clarifying Questions

Use AskUserQuestion to ask the user any questions you need answered before creating. Only ask questions where the answer isn't obvious from context. Common questions include:

  • Scope: Should this be global (~/.claude/agents/) or project-level (.claude/agents/)?
  • Tools: What tools should the agent have access to? (Read-only vs full access)
  • Name: What should the agent be called? (suggest one based on context)
  • Permissions: Should the agent auto-accept edits, require approval, or be read-only?
  • Model: Should it use a specific model (haiku for speed, opus for power) or inherit?
  • Memory: Should it learn across sessions?

Do NOT ask questions you can answer from context. If the user said "create an agent that reviews code" you don't need to ask "what should the agent do?"

Step 4: Create the Agent

Based on the docs you fetched and the user's answers:

  1. Write the agent file: ~/.claude/agents/<name>.md or .claude/agents/<name>.md
  2. Include proper YAML frontmatter with name, description, tools, and any other relevant fields
  3. Write a clear, focused system prompt in the markdown body
  4. The system prompt should tell the agent exactly what it does, how to approach tasks, and what to output

Step 5: Confirm and Test

Tell the user:

  • Where the agent was created
  • How it will be triggered (description matching or explicit request)
  • What tools it has access to
  • Suggest they test it with a sample task

Quality Standards

  • Each agent should excel at ONE focused job
  • Description must clearly state when Claude should delegate to this agent
  • Tool access should be minimal - only grant what's needed
  • System prompt should be specific and actionable, not vague
  • Include a clear workflow or checklist in the system prompt
  • File is a single .md file (not a directory with SKILL.md like skills)
  • Name field should be lowercase with hyphens
